Repairs and modifies firearms to blueprint and customer specifications, using handtools and machines, such as grinders, planers, and millers: Fits action and barrel into stock and aligns parts. Specifically, they may be responsible for improving a guns accuracy, restoring old and antique firearms to working conditions, providing rust inspection and mounting scopes and sights. To become a gunsmith, it is very likely that any potential employer or educational program will require you to pass a background check. More specifically, you may be responsible for accurizing (improving gun accuracy) a gun, restoring old or dilapidated firearms to working conditions, mounting scopes, bluing (providing rust protection), installing gun sights and creating custom load mechanisms for user-specified ammunition.
